What is the difference between Draconus form and Dragon Form
Draconus is a form powered by Draconus Energy (the Awakened Elemental of Energy). It represents Lloyd’s second True Potential, which can be shared with and accessed by other Elemental Masters through their connection to him.

Unlike the Draconus Form, the Dragon Form is powered by Golden Power/Energy. It is a form that can be used by any Elemental Master who possesses one of the Four Elements of Creation, or by an individual who has dragon blood.
